The formula
A 300-mile one-way trip at 28 mpg, with gas at $3.45/gallon: 300 / 28 = 10.71 gallons needed, for a cost of $36.96. The same trip round-trip (600 miles total) would cost roughly $73.93.

Why real-world mileage often differs from the sticker rating
EPA or manufacturer-rated fuel efficiency figures come from standardized lab testing conditions that rarely match everyday driving. City driving with frequent stops, cold weather, highway speeds above 65 mph, a loaded roof rack, or aggressive acceleration can all reduce real-world efficiency by 10-20% or more below the rated figure. For the most accurate cost estimate, track your own actual mileage over a few tanks (dividing miles driven by gallons used) rather than relying solely on the window sticker or manufacturer specification, especially if your typical driving conditions differ from standard test conditions.

Why does L/100km work backwards compared to mpg?
Mpg measures distance per unit of fuel (higher is better), while L/100km measures fuel per unit of distance (lower is better) - both describe the same underlying efficiency, just inverted, which is why a "good" number looks very different between the two systems.
Does this calculator account for traffic, idling, or air conditioning use?
Not directly - these factors reduce real-world efficiency below the rated figure. Using a slightly lower efficiency number than your car's official rating (or your own tracked average) helps account for typical driving conditions like this.
